LncRNA MAGI2-AS3 is down-regulated in intervertebral disc degeneration and participates in the regulation of FasL expression in nucleus pulposus cells.

BACKGROUND It is known that Fas ligand (FasL) is involved in the development of intervertebral disc degeneration (IDD). A recent study reported that lncRNA MAGI2-AS3 up-regulated the expression of FasL to promote breast cancer. Therefore, we investigated the roles that lncRNA MAGI2-AS3 might play in IDD. METHODS A total of 66 IDD patients (IDD group) and 58 healthy volunteers (Control group) were recruited in this study. Quantitative real-time PCR (qRT-PCR) and western blot were used to investigate gene expression levels. Cell transfections were carried out to analyze gene interactions. The diagnostic value of lncRNA MAGI2-AS3 for IDD was assessed by ROC curve analysis. RESULTS The expression levels of plasma lncRNA MAGI2-AS3 were lower in IDD patients compared to that in the control group. Down-regulation of lncRNA MAGI2-AS3 effectively distinguished IDD patients from the control group. The expression levels of plasma lncRNA MAGI2-AS3 were significantly increased after the treatments. Over-expression of lncRNA MAGI2-AS3 inhibited the expression of FasL, while the silencing of lncRNA MAGI2-AS3 promoted the expression of FasL in nucleus pulposus (NP) cells. CONCLUSIONS Therefore, lncRNA MAGI2-AS3 is down-regulated in IDD and participates in the regulation of FasL expression in nucleus pulposus (NP) cells.

LncRNA MAGI2-AS3在椎间盘退变中下调,并参与髓核细胞FasL表达的调节。

背景技术已知Fas配体(FasL)参与椎间盘退变(IDD)的发展。最近的一项研究报道,lncRNA MAGI2-AS3上调FasL的表达以促进乳腺癌。因此,我们研究了lncRNA MAGI2-AS3在IDD中可能发挥的作用。方法总共招募了66名IDD患者(IDD组)和58名健康志愿者(对照组)。实时定量PCR(qRT-PCR)和蛋白质印迹用于研究基因表达水平。进行细胞转染以分析基因相互作用。通过ROC曲线分析评估lncRNA MAGI2-AS3对IDD的诊断价值。结果IDD患者血浆lncRNA MAGI2-AS3的表达水平低于对照组。lncRNA MAGI2-AS3的下调可有效区分IDD患者与对照组。处理后血浆lncRNA MAGI2-AS3的表达水平显着升高。lncRNA MAGI2-AS3的过表达抑制FasL的表达,而lncRNA MAGI2-AS3的沉默则促进髓核(NP)细胞中FasL的表达。结论因此,lncRNA MAGI2-AS3在IDD中被下调,并参与髓核(NP)细胞FasL表达的调节。
